Transaction 8ed728dd6a32c52154f7193b30c4131d100c000c30b58f36f22752b6c251d25d
1 Input
1 Output
-
8ed728dd6a32c52154f7193b30c4131d100c000c30b58f36f22752b6c251d25d:0
- value
- 78886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590a798940734234158df146c4ab546b57686fc5 OP_EQUAL
- address
- 39opcR2cMQF2RJwQWRNpYJQj8eBnHwwz3L